Transaction 31b379ef66a18dfe70798719bc9c8a121cf4eaea2c6a4d11756cadf4fbb3cc26

1 Input
2 Outputs
  • 31b379ef66a18dfe70798719bc9c8a121cf4eaea2c6a4d11756cadf4fbb3cc26:0
  • value  903529
    address  1C4voz1z5xJRkdY6vaqpZ6fhzaiGpLaqZn
  • 31b379ef66a18dfe70798719bc9c8a121cf4eaea2c6a4d11756cadf4fbb3cc26:1
  • value  346608827
    address  1JTeVB1qUHeA8cwsPHpxnNwjHoPDrvB7ny